Find the mean of each of the following frequency distribution:
Class interval: | 0-10 | 10-20 | 20-30 | 30-40 | 40-50 |
Frequency: | 9 | 12 | 15 | 10 | 14. |
To do:
We have to find the mean of the given frequency distribution.
Solution:
Let the assumed mean be $A=25$
We know that,
Mean $=A+\frac{\sum{f_id_i}}{\sum{f_i}}$
Therefore,
Mean $=25+\frac{80}{60}$
$=25+\frac{4}{3}$
$=25+1.333$
$=26.333$
The mean of the given frequency distribution is $26.333$.
